Some of the more well-known acts on Mystic Records are NOFX, Dr. Know, RKL, Battalion of Saints, Ill Repute, Agression and The Mentors.
Mystic is credited with developing several innovations in the independent record scene of the 1980s including the introduction of Super Sevens ( vinyl discs the size of a 45 but which played at the same speed as an LP and have seven songs ), releasing records in limited edition on colored vinyl, and issuing records in series.
Mystic series include " The Sound of Hollywood ," " We Got Power " ( 40 + bands on one LP ), " Copulation " ( songs about the police ), and " Mystic Sampler " ( cuts from various records released in that year ).

The village is located on the Mystic River, which flows into Long Island Sound, providing access to the sea.
As a result of the Pequot War, Pequot dominance ended with the emergence of English settlements on the open land of Mystic.
John Mason, one of the captains who led the colonists against the Pequot, had previously been granted on the eastern banks of the Mystic River.
Thomas Miner, who had immigrated to Massachusetts with John Winthrop, was granted many land plots, the main one lying on Quiambaug Cove, just east of the Mystic River.
Many men, however, actually brought their wives and children which indicated their plans on forming a community in the Mystic River Valley.
However those families living on the east side of the Mystic River were unable make any use of the Pequot Trail, like Miner and Mason, and desired for the creation of a bridge to connect the two.
